Image of Integral V Technology icon   Integral V Technology

Integral-V™ Technology (IVT) uses T-slot structural aluminum framing integrated with V-races. IVT provides a complete system build with or without having to incorporate any structural support framework. Hardened steel raceways are directly embedded unto the Integral-V Integrated rail to eliminate fasteners and reduce mounting components. The Integrated rail utilizes PBC Linear's SIMO® machining process for precise mounting and alignment on all critical sides—ensuring dimensional and rail form accuracy. This allows the IVT carriages to roll smoothly, accurately and quietly along the rail. Available in 3 different configurations, Integrated IVT is a perfect choice for medium format material handling, machine-tool guidance and extended length transfer applications.

  • Rails available cut-to-length up to 4m (13ft)
  • SIMO® machined for precision qualified rail surfaces to within .050mm (.002")
  • Hardened steel races eliminate fasteners and reduce mounting components by 40%
  • Handles loads up to 7230 N (1625 lbs)
  • High speed capacity 12 m/s (472 in/s)
  • Standard and extended length carriages available
  • Carriages equipped with sealed, lubricated for life rollers
  • Carriages available with wheel covers, scrapers and wipers

Integrated

Integrated Integral-V™ Technology (IVT) uses T-slot structural aluminum framing integrated with V-races. The Integrated IVT provides a complete system build without having to incorporate any structural support framework. Hardened steel raceways are directly embedded unto the Integral-V Integrated rail to eliminate fasteners and reduce mounting components.

  • Rails available cut-to-length up to 4m (13ft)
  • SIMO® machined for precision qualified rail surfaces to within .050mm (.002")
  • Handles loads up to 7230 N (1625 lbs)
  • High speed capacity 12 m/s (472 in/s)

 

Bolt-On

Bolt-on Integral-V™ Technology (IVT) uses parallel linear V-Guides to adapt to any mounting surface for assured accuracy and precision. Available in single and double-wide extrusions for enhanced load capacities with hardened steel raceways which are directly embedded unto the Integral-V Bolt-on rail to eliminate fasteners and reduce mounting components. Hardened steel raceways are directly embedded unto the Integral-V Bolt-on rail to eliminate fasteners and reduce mounting components.

  • Rails available cut-to-length up to 4m (13ft)
  • SIMO® machined for precision qualified rail surfaces to within .050mm (.002")
  • Handles loads up to 5560 N (1250 lbs)
  • High speed capacity 12 m/s (472 in/s)

 

Compact Guides

Compact Guide Integral-V™ Technology provide a cost-effective alternative to competing profile rail technology while still ensuring stable, smooth and accurate linear guidance.

  • Rails available cut-to-length up to 4m (13ft)
  • The standard compact series handles loads up to 2330N (523 lbs) 
  • The HD compact series provides load capacity up to 5560 N (1250 lbs)
  • SIMO® machined for precision qualified rail surfaces
  • High speed capacity 10 m/s (393 in/s)

 

Modular Bolt-On

Modular Bolt-on Integral-V™ Technology (IVT) is perfect for moving door/panel applications by easily installing into existing framing. Hardened steel raceways are directly embedded unto the Integral-V Modular Bolt-on aluminum rail to eliminate fasteners and reduce mounting components.

  • Rails available cut-to-length up to 4m (13ft)
  • Bolts onto existing structural framing
  • SIMO® machined for precision qualified rail surfaces
  • High speed capacity 12 m/s (472 in/s) using IVT V-Guide size 3 wheel/stud for easy carriage integration to rail
